Output 3ca74c9950790795563ae2e6243d893e263b5a662be32c13a9081a7c9c52f6be:1

value
4525762
script pubkey
OP_0 OP_PUSHBYTES_20 8b8c9a6b514d3f02984c0e2e42eb55200e2d5453
address
ltc1q3wxf5663f5ls9xzvpchy9664yq8z64zne3zh4p
transaction
3ca74c9950790795563ae2e6243d893e263b5a662be32c13a9081a7c9c52f6be
spent
true